Ealy Posted April 13, 2014 Posted April 13, 2014 We unloaded the boat today about 7:15 at Ruark. Fished secondary points and rock transitions in Sons and the Big Sac all day. Most of our early fish were caught on stickbaits (6 keepers) on rock transitions and secondary points. As the day warmed up and the wind we picked up 6 more keepers on spinnerbaits and wiggle warts.A brown jig with green pumpkin trailer was the most productive today along with several on a tube. We honestly had right at 20 keeper bass today and another 20 or so shorts. By 2:00 they had pretty much shut down for us and loaded back up at 3:45.
